<h3>What is a correlation coefficient?</h3>
- It is an index that measures correlation between two variables, assuming values between -1 and 1.
- If it is positive, the relation is positive, that is, they are direct proportional. If it is negative, they are inverse proportional.
- If the absolute value of the correlation coefficient is greater than 0.6, the relationship is strong.
Inserting the values of a table, the x-values as 25, 28, 30, 31, 33, 40, and the y-values as 7.5, 6, 5.5, 5, 4.5, 4.5, the coefficient is of -0.85, which is negative and strong.

5x(x-3) = (x-2)(5x - 1) - 5
5x^2 - 15x = 5x^2 - x - 10x + 2 - 5
5x^2 - 15x = 5x^2 - 11x - 3
5x^2 - 11x - 3 - 5x^2 + 15x = 0
4x - 3 = 0
4x = 3
x = 3/4 or 0.75
